Luxury Vinyl Flooring

Luxury Vinyl Flooring is a high-end flooring solution known for its stylish appearance, resilience, and versatility, making it an ideal choice for creating luxurious hospitality environments.

The Elegance and Practicality of Luxury Vinyl Flooring in Hospitality

In the world of hospitality, every detail within an interior space contributes to the guest experience. Flooring, often an overlooked element, plays a crucial role in this dynamic. Luxury vinyl flooring (LVF) has emerged as a preferred choice for many architects and designers in the hospitality industry due to its aesthetic appeal, versatility, and durability.

Understanding Luxury Vinyl Flooring

Luxury vinyl flooring is a type of flooring that offers the sophisticated look of natural materials like wood or stone while providing enhanced durability and ease of maintenance. Unlike traditional materials, LVF is designed to withstand heavy foot traffic, making it ideal for hospitality environments such as hotel lobbies, guest rooms, and dining areas. Its waterproof and scratch-resistant properties ensure it retains its pristine appearance even under strenuous conditions.

Why Luxury Vinyl Flooring Stands Out

1. Aesthetic Versatility

One of the primary reasons LVF is favored in hospitality interior design is its ability to mimic the luxurious textures and patterns of natural materials. With advanced printing techniques, LVF can convincingly replicate the intricate grains of oak or the marbled elegance of stone tiles. This allows hospitality brands to convey opulence and style without the costs associated with sourcing and maintaining natural materials.

2. Durability and Ease of Maintenance

Hospitality spaces are subject to a constant flow of guests, staff, and even luggage-wheel traffic. Traditional luxury materials, while beautiful, may not always withstand such usage without showing wear. LVF offers a robust alternative, designed specifically to endure without sacrificing aesthetics. Its easy maintenance means that it can be cleaned with simple solutions, a significant advantage in high-turnover environments.

3. Cost-Effectiveness

Luxury vinyl flooring provides high-end design at a fraction of the cost of real wood, stone, or ceramic tiles. For hospitality businesses, this represents a strategic investment that delivers aesthetic appeal without overextending budgets. Over time, the low maintenance costs compound the economic benefits.

4. Installation and Flexibility

Compared to other luxury materials, LVF is relatively easier and faster to install. It can be laid over most subfloors, which makes retrofit projects more feasible. Additionally, the product comes in various forms—planks, tiles, or sheets—offering flexibility to designers looking to achieve specific visual and tactile effects.

Designing with Luxury Vinyl Flooring: Tips for Success

1. Coordinate with Overall Design Theme

Select LVF patterns and colors that complement the overall design theme of your hospitality space. Whether it’s rustic, minimalist, or ultra-modern, there are LVF options available to suit any aesthetic vision.

2. Consider Acoustics

One potential drawback of any hard flooring surface is sound transmission. To mitigate noise, consider using acoustic underlays or selecting LVF products designed to minimize sound generation, ensuring a serene environment for your guests.

3. Sustainability

Many luxury vinyl flooring products are now produced with eco-friendly materials and processes. Look for certifications or manufacturers that emphasize sustainable practices, aligning with the growing consumer preference for environmentally-conscious hospitality brands.
